WhatsApp Messenger blocks Telegram links

WhatsApp Messenger blocks Telegram linkWhatsApp Messenger the war with the application has begun Telegram, the WhatsApp company taking the decision to stop promoting the competing application with hundreds of millions of users worldwide in its own network.

More specifically, WhatsApp Messenger blocks Telegram links introduced by users in conversations with various contacts, but for now everything is done only in the Android application of those from WhatsApp, the change will also reach the iPhone.

According to those who use the application WhatsApp Messenger for Android, the links that direct users to the Telegram website, and implicitly the respective application, cannot be accessed or even copied from the application interface, they are only displayed as texts.

In practice, WhatsApp Messenger blocks in Android any kind of interaction with links that mention the Telegram website, so its users will not be able to access competitors' websites except by entering the domain directly in the browser used for surfing the Internet.

The measure taken by WhatsApp demonstrates how big the competition between WhatsApp Messenger and Telegram is, but also what actions the companies are willing to take to ensure that they do not lose users to the competing service in one way or another.

For now, it is not known when WhatsApp Messenger will block Telegram links on the iPhone as well, but the change will definitely be present in the future.
